My Review of Modern Times
I personally really enjoyed the film Modern Times by Charlie Chaplin. Chaplin used this film to send a message to the audience throughout the scenes. It kept the audience entertained but it made the message clear. All the elements that he used in this film illustrated or symbolized something about his character or his views about different subjects that were going on in that time. Chaplin was able to express him self during this film. It made the audience think about the social issues that were going on like how they were in a way being abused by the machines and the factories. How the police system authority system was not that best. How poverty was a big deal in that time and many people struggled to get the food on the table because of the lack of jobs. Through out his film he let us know through comedy and humor his significant thoughts. I think he chose a right way to show his ideas in the form he illustrated all the details in this film.
